Add wishlist functionality with support for AJAX, Elementor, Oxygen, and more. == Description == **Light Wishlist** is a simple and fast wishlist plugin for WooCommerce. It offers a minimal UI with customization options directly from the WordPress admin. **Features:** - Add/remove products to/from wishlist with AJAX. - Works with logged-in users. - Fully translatable and customizable. - Admin settings page for icon, color, text, and layout. - Supports Elementor and Oxygen Builder (optional toggles). - Auto-insert wishlist button in WooCommerce product loops (configurable). - Shortcodes and PHP functions available for custom placement. - Uses FontAwesome icons. **Shortcodes Available:** - `[light-wishlist-add-item]` – Render the wishlist button manually. - `[wishlist-user-table]` – Display the user's wishlist table. == Installation == 1. Upload the plugin folder to the `/wp-content/plugins/` directory. 2. Activate the plugin through the 'Plugins' menu in WordPress. 3. Go to **Settings > Wishlist** to configure icons, text, and other options. == Frequently Asked Questions == = Can I change the wishlist icon? = Yes, you can choose from several FontAwesome icons in the settings. = Is it compatible with page builders? = Yes, it supports Elementor and Oxygen. Enable support from the plugin settings. = Does it use cookies or sessions? = No. Wishlist is stored in the database for logged-in users only. = Does this plugin work without WooCommerce? = No. WooCommerce is required for this plugin to function. == Screenshots == 1.
